Technical Development Plan

The South Delta United Technical Development Plan is based on the core philosophies outlined by the Canadian Soccer Association and Sport Canada in their Long Term Player Develpment Plan (LTPD), which addresses the need to develop the core skills under a more educational and purposeful manner. LTPD is a player centered approach, meaning that the individual development of the player is first and foremost.

The primary targets of the SDU Development Plan are to create an inclusive, safe, responsible and education pathway for our young players to develop a love of the game, develop as an individual player, and also develop as young people.

The areas of player, coach and referee development are intertwined and codependent. The aligning of these three pathways are crucial to our player centered target. Without strong consideration to the coach and referee education, the player will not develop to their full potential.
